Output fbeff16b0db56fcadc48519cc10c18bb3ddb6b591b320f54be43179ea31bd190:1

value
133026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90fac875ef9c01658e282a13e067b9858f53c148 OP_EQUAL
address
3EubeswXKxvfhHzt5XxRN7MoTKv4bKKpuv
transaction
fbeff16b0db56fcadc48519cc10c18bb3ddb6b591b320f54be43179ea31bd190
confirmations
328184
spent
true